After the latest Email Client update (6.11.0419.0755)  the native contact sync both for google and yahoo email accounts does not work. It seems just a few people have been affected thou. When I get the Activation screen, after adding the email, only Calendar shows on the list. Before I would have Calendar and Contacts and both would show a progression (1/X or X%). Some times I get an never seen before Activation icon on the homescreen, that will be there, stuck at 10%, even thou the process has already finished with the calendar and is not doing anything about contacts.

I call BS on whoever told you that BIS doesn't do Contact and Calendar sync.

 

I had a similar issue after my recent OS upgrade with my 9800.  

 

Go to Messages >> Options >> [e-mail account] >> Look for Wireless Sync.  If you are not given the option to enable it, or it is not there at all, then that's your problem.  Personally, I'd do this process even it it does let you enable it just to be on the safe side.

 

The solution is definitely multi-step and lengthy, but it seemed to do the trick for me.

 

    1. Log into BIS and copy your filters into a backup text file on your desktop.
      • (I typically name my filters XXXX [To:], YYYY [From:], ZZZ [Subject:], etc... so they are easy to replicate if lost
    2. Make sure that you've backed up all your contacts and calendars, preferrably using either Blackberry Protect or SmrtGuard.  I say this for those reading this that may not think to do it.
    3. Delete the e-mail act from the BIS interface.
    4. Connect Blackberry to Desktop.
    5. Open BB Desktop Manager.
    6. Delete Service Books.
    7. Perform a hard reset.
    8. Manually force a "Register your phone on the network"
      1. On the Home screen of the BlackBerry smartphone, click Options, or click Settings > Options.
        • Note: The location of the Options screen depends on the version of BlackBerry Device Software and the theme running on the BlackBerry smartphone.
      2. Complete the step associated with the appropriate version of BlackBerry Device Software (http://www.blackberry.com/btsc/KB16383):
          • For BlackBerry Device Software 6.0, perform the following steps:
            • Device > Advanced System Settings > Host Routing Table
          • For BlackBerry Device Software 4.1 through 5.0, perform the following steps:
            • Advanced Options > Host Routing Table
          • For BlackBerry Device Software 3.7.1 through 4.0.2:
            • Host Routing Table
          • BlackBerry Device Software 3.0 through 3.7:
            • Network
          • Note: On some BlackBerry smartphones that run BlackBerry Device Software 3.7.1, Register Now might be found as an option in the Network menu.
          • BlackBerry Device Software 2.0 through 2.7:
            • Network Settings
      3. Press the Menu key and click Register Now.
    9. Resend your service books for the default @xxxx.blackberry.com email account.
        1. From the Home screen, click Setup > Email Settings or Email Accounts.
        2. If required select Internet Mail Account.
        3. In the Email Accounts screen, display the menu and click Service Books.
        4. Click Send Service Books.
    10. Add your email account in BIS.
        • DO NOT enable Contact or Calendar sync yet.
    11. Change the default services to your new email account
        • Calendar (CICAL)
        • Contact List (SYNC)
    12. Just to be on the safe-side, I'd do a hard reboot again.
    13. Go into the e-mail settings on your Blackberry, NOT the BIS web interface.
    14. Go down to synchronization and enable Contacts and Calendar.
    15. Your BB should appear to go through an Enterprise Activation.
        • Even though you are on BIS, this is perfectly normal and expected
    16. Once it is done, you can confirm it has been completed by checking the status of "Wireless Synchronization" in the Address Book App.
    17. It is extremely possible that you might end up with several duplicate contacts after finishing this process. 
      • To remove the duplicates on Gmail which will push to the Blackberry, I'd recommend a web service called scrubly.com
      • Remember that BIS does not sync the following contact fields:
        • Avatar pictures
        • Groups/Categories
        • Birthday/Anniversaries
        • Instant Messaging
      • BIS will only sync contacts under "My Contacts".  Make sure that, in Gmail, you have turned off "Create contacts for auto-complete:"
      • The BIS Calendar Sync will only sync your default Google Calendar.  It will not sync any of your other calendars.  You can only have one calendar per email address.

Once you have the carrier e-mail, I don't try to change the default services just yet.

Resend the service books, reboot.

Add the email act on BIS. Don't select Contact/Calendar Sync.

Wait about 5 minutes then reboot again.

Now go into the BB email settings, enable the Contact/Calendar Sync.

Finally, reboot again and change the default services.
